He’d received three World Cups, scored targets galore and turn into a world icon, however Pelé wasn’t fairly finished but, so off he went to the US and helped rework the game of soccer in North America.

The Brazilian nice was satisfied to come back out of retirement, signing in 1975 for the New York Cosmos for 3 extra seasons.

Pelé had seemingly performed his final skilled sport months previous to becoming a member of the North American Soccer League (NASL) facet, hanging up his boots after making 638 appearances for his childhood membership Santos.

It was virtually unfathomable that Pelé would ever play for another membership other than Santos, however he joined the Cosmos halfway by the 1975 season on a $1.67-million-a-year contract, regardless of soccer struggling to generate a lot curiosity in North America on the time.

Pelé got here, noticed and conquered and by the point ‘O Rei’ (“The King”) left in 1977, he was an NASL champion who had helped spark a soccer growth.

“Throughout three seasons with the Cosmos, Pelé helped rework the home panorama of the game of soccer,” the Cosmos mentioned in a press release after his dying this week.

“The place as soon as there had been baseball diamonds, now there have been additionally soccer pitches.

“The Cosmos and their King not solely began a sporting revolution in America, in addition they traveled the world to unfold the Gospel of the Stunning Recreation.”

Even now, after virtually 50 years, Pelé’s affect remains to be being felt throughout each the lads’s and girls’s video games in North America.

His transfer to Cosmos paved the best way for different greats, equivalent to Giorgio Chinaglia and Franz Beckenbauer, to comply with swimsuit and though the NASL finally folded in 1984, it set a blueprint for Main League Soccer (MLS) when it was established in 1993.

Superstars equivalent to David Beckham, Gareth Bale, Thierry Henry and Zlatan Ibrahimovic have all adopted within the footsteps of Pelé by serving to develop the game in North America by taking part in within the MLS.

Pelé opened the door for more superstars to play in the US.

Soccer within the US is now thriving, with the US Nationwide Males’s Group impressing in the course of the Qatar 2022 World Cup.

Scouts from internationally are actually North America to find new expertise, with the game cemented into the material of society and being naturally handed down by generations.

A lot of the early work was finished within the Seventies because of Pelé’s pure skill and infectious smile.

Within the season earlier than Pelé joined Santos in 1975, the Cosmos’ largest attendance for a match was somewhat over 8,000 individuals.

Throughout his ultimate and most profitable season in 1977, the common crowd was 42,689 for residence video games, together with three events when the attendance was over 70,000, in response to the Society for American Soccer Historical past.

When Pelé joined the Cosmos he was aged 34 and he went on to attain a complete of 37 targets in 64 NASL matches.

“Pelé’s choice to convey his artistry to the US with the New York Cosmos within the Seventies was a transformative second for the game on this nation,” MLS Commissioner Don Garber mentioned in a press release.

“As Pelé captivated followers all through the US and Canada, it demonstrated the ability of the sport and the limitless potentialities for the game.”

The Cosmos’ first Normal Supervisor Clive Toye performed a key position in getting the game’s then greatest celebrity to hitch the Cosmos.

A former journalist who was closely concerned within the NASL’s creation, Toye had a imaginative and prescient for the way forward for soccer within the US and believed Pelé was the person to make that dream a actuality.

Nevertheless, Toye and the Cosmos confronted some stiff opposition from world wide for Pelé’s signature.

Heavyweight political intervention was even dropped at bear, with Pelé saying then US Secretary of State Henry Kissinger had helped persuade him to hitch the Cosmos.

“At the moment, I had a variety of proposals to play in England, Italy, Spain, Mexico however I mentioned no. After 18 years, I wish to relaxation as a result of I’m going to retire,” Pelé informed CNN in 2011.

“Then appeared the proposal to go to New York as a result of they wish to make soccer massive in the US. That was the explanation. I began my mission.”

After the Cosmos received the NASL title in 1977, a farewell match in opposition to Pelé’s former group Santos was organized, with the Brazilian taking part in a half for either side in what can be his ultimate official sport.

After the testimonial, he addressed greater than 70,000 individuals inside a packed New York’s Giants Stadium, main the gang in a chant of “Love, love, love.”

A becoming finish, maybe, for a person who unfold pleasure wherever he went and who helped set up soccer as a lifestyle in North America.
